Council of Saudi Chambers inks MoU to establish Saudi-Greek Business Council


(MENAFN) According to SPA, the Council of Saudi Chambers inked a memorandum of understanding (MoU) to set a Saudi-Greek Business Council to improve mutual trade and investment amid both countries.

It plans to inaugurate new areas for economic cooperation, ease continuous interaction amid the Saudi and Greek business sectors, and get rid of difficulties to doing business.

In addition; the new council is going to exchange information on available markets and investment opportunities, allow commercial and investment partnerships, and offer recommendations to the relevant authorities in both countries to improve economic ties.

The deal includes that the joint business council is going to be composed of representatives of Saudi and Greek business owners interested in investment and trade, also the council is going to hold periodic assemblies in Riyadh and Athens to tackle opportunities for trade and investment collaborations amid both countries.
